The Gospel

We love because God first loved us (1 John 4:19).

Jesus Christ laid down His life for those who receive Him as Lord and Savior (Romans 10:9-10). Because of the fall (Genesis 3), we are all dead in our sins and deserving of Gods wrath. But God, in His unfailing love, sent His only Son to take our place so that we will not remain dead in our sin, but rather have eternal life (John 3:16). We are desperate sinners in need of a savior. And we are grateful beyond measure for the saving grace that is in Christ Jesus alone. His blood is our atonement and is a gift given freely to all who will receive it.

Without the Gospel, our work is meaningless. We do what we do because He did what He did. Our work is done for God’s glory alone, not ours. Our works are an outpouring of the love and grace we can freely give because we have freely received it.

We aren’t perfect – as individuals or as an organization – but we fall into the amazing grace that God has for us. We are learning and growing and doing all we can to walk in obedience to the Lord, trusting in Him fully.
